1. Determine Your Water Source
Before you start shopping, decide whether you’ll be using bottled water or a direct connection to your building's water line.
✅ Bottled Water Dispensers
These models are compatible with standard 5 gallon water dispenser bottles. They're easy to set up, portable, and ideal for homes, offices, gyms, and event spaces. Most users in Dubai prefer this option due to its flexibility.
✅ Point-of-Use Dispensers
These connect directly to your plumbing and include internal filtration systems. They're best for larger offices or commercial use but require installation and access to a clean water source.
2. Choose Between Top-Load and Bottom-Load Designs
Both styles of water dispensers have their own pros and cons.
🔹 Top-Loading Dispensers
-
The 5 gallon water bottle is placed on top
-
Easier to monitor water levels
-
More affordable
-
Requires lifting heavy bottles
🔹 Bottom-Loading Dispensers
-
Bottles are hidden inside the cabinet
-
Better for people who can't lift heavy loads
-
Sleeker appearance
-
Typically more expensive
Choose the style that suits your home or office setup and daily usage habits.
3. Look at Temperature Control Options
Most hot and cold water dispensers have dual-temperature faucets. Check the actual temperature range for each:
-
Hot Water: Around 85–95°C (ideal for tea, coffee, and instant food)
-
Cold Water: Around 5–10°C (perfect for drinking in hot weather)
Some models even include a third faucet for room temperature water—ideal for kids or certain recipes.
4. Check for Safety Features
Safety is especially important if you have children or pets around.
🔒 Key features to consider:
-
Child Safety Lock on the hot water tap
-
Auto Shut-Off to prevent overheating
-
Leak Detection Sensors
-
Overload Protection
These small details can make a big difference in preventing accidents or water damage.
5. Consider the Cooling and Heating Technology
There are two main types of technology used in water dispensers:
🔹 Compressor Cooling
-
Faster cooling
-
Ideal for heavy usage or warmer climates
-
Slightly bulkier and heavier
🔹 Thermoelectric Cooling
-
Energy-efficient
-
Quieter operation
-
Best for light to medium use
For Dubai’s climate, compressor-cooled dispensers are generally the better choice if you frequently use chilled water.

7. Evaluate Energy Efficiency
A hot and cold water dispenser runs 24/7, so energy use matters. Look for:
-
Energy-saving mode or night mode
-
Thermostat control
-
Power consumption labels
An energy-efficient model helps you reduce your monthly utility bills without sacrificing performance.
8. Maintenance and Cleaning
Routine maintenance keeps your 5 gallon water dispenser hygienic and functioning well.
Look for:
-
Removable drip trays for easy cleaning
-
Self-cleaning features using UV or ozone
-
Easy access to inner parts for manual cleaning
Cleaning should be simple, especially in a home or office with frequent usage.
